About 24 Barton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

24 Barton Street is a mid-terrace house in Macclesfield (SK11 6RX). It has a recorded floor area of 60 m² (around 646 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(May 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in July 2021 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83).

One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2015.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 79% of similar EPCs). On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£226/sq ft) was about 39.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£146,000 in November 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
